About the Curriculum

Learning Undefeated created an adaptable, cross-disciplinary framework and model activities for the Texas Mobile STEM Labs to introduce Texas teachers and students to principles of engineering design, aligned to Texas Essential Knowledge and Skills (TEKS). The common framework includes defining a problem; identifying criteria and constraints; designing, building, and testing; and evaluation and iteration.
Learning Undefeated provides all instruction and the materials needed to complete engineering design challenges. All activities focus on students designing solutions to problems and allow for collaboration and exploration of the content.

  • Activity Duration: All activities are 60 minutes in duration.
  • Grades: Kindergarten through Grade 8
  • Class Size: Texas Mobile STEM Labs can accommodate 24 students per class.

Point of Contact & Reminders

One contact person must be assigned for school visit. Learning Undefeated staff will send an email to the main contact to begin coordinating details for the mobile lab visit. Learning Undefeated and the main school contact will work together to select a date for a pre-visit meeting to discuss logistics. Teachers must maintain communication with our staff in a timely manner to ensure the best experience for students. Failure to do so may lead to your week being given to an alternate school.

calendar icon

Pre-Visit: Six Weeks Out

Learning Undefeated will schedule a time for a virtual pre-visit meeting with the main school contact. Pre-visits should be scheduled at least six (6) weeks prior to the school visit. The pre-visit allows teachers and Learning Undefeated to discuss documents, parking, scheduling, activities, and expectations.

Pre-Visit Expectations:

  • Attendance: All participating teachers should be present at the pre-visit however if not possible, the primary contact will distribute all necessary information.
  • Preparedness: The menu of activities will be shared prior to the meeting and teachers should identify activities of interest and bring any questions about the program to pre-visit.
  • Collaboration:  School staff should collaborate internally to create the schedule of classes for the visit. Learning Undefeated instructors will provide advice and logistics recommendations for the proposed schedule.
  • Proactiveness: The lead school contact should print all important documents prior to pre-visit. Parking location will be discussed, each school is asked to come prepared with proposed parking locations.

During Your Lab Visit

  • Standard Operating Hours:
    Learning Undefeated educators will work with teachers to create a schedule of classes.  All classes are one-hour long with a 10-minute break to reset for the next class. The schedule should also allow time for staff to take a one-hour lunch break daily. Learning Undefeated does not conduct classes on Mondays, which are designated travel/setup days. If there are classes held on Friday, instruction will end at noon.
  • On-Site Support:
    Learning Undefeated educators will be on site to facilitate classes and logistics for the mobile lab visit. A representative from the school must remain onboard the lab while students are participating in mobile lab sessions.
  • On-Lab Student Experience:
    The Texas Mobile STEM Labs program offers TEA-approved one-of-a-kind experiences for K-8 students and teachers to solve engineering design challenges that integrate content knowledge aligned to the TEKS.
  • Evaluation Plan:
    Students, teachers, and an administrator are required to participate in surveys to help provide feedback and improve future programs. No personal or identifying data will be collected from students. Individuals may opt out of participating in the program at any time.
